An Overview of Sumitomo Rubber Industries, Ltd.

An Overview of Sumitomo Rubber Industries, Ltd.

Founded in 1909, Sumitomo Rubber Industries, Ltd. has evolved into a prominent player in the global tire and rubber products market. The company is headquartered in Osaka, Japan, and operates with a motto of 'Contributing to Society through Innovative Technology.' Sumitomo Rubber specializes in a wide range of products, including tires for passenger vehicles, trucks, and motorcycles, as well as industrial rubber products and sporting goods. As of 2024, Sumitomo Rubber reported total sales exceeding ¥1 trillion (approximately $7.5 billion), underlining its substantial market presence and consumer trust.

Company's Financial Performance in the Latest Financial Reports

For the fiscal year ending December 2023, Sumitomo Rubber Industries achieved a record-breaking revenue of ¥1.05 trillion (around $7.8 billion), which represents a growth of 12% compared to the previous year. This growth is primarily driven by the demand for its main product lines, particularly the passenger car tire segment.

The following table summarizes key financial metrics from the latest financial report:

Metric 2023 2022 Growth (%)
Revenue ¥1.05 trillion ¥0.94 trillion 12%
Operating Profit ¥120 billion ¥95 billion 26.3%
Net Income ¥80 billion ¥60 billion 33.3%
Earnings Per Share (EPS) ¥150 ¥110 36.4%

This performance reflects robust growth in various markets, with significant contributions from both domestic and international sales. Key regions such as North America and Europe witnessed a surge in demand, contributing to a healthy export revenue.
